My name is Kevin, I do a lot of programming and web work on this site for Jill. As most you have noticed, the site hasn’t been happy for about the last 5 days or so, so being the “webmaster” I figured I’d give you all an explanation…..

Jill has done a great job developing and promoting this site and it’s growing at a pretty fast pace, and is starting to get a little too big for it’s britches. So last week we tried upgrading the server to a new supposedly bigger and better server. As you can guess it didn’t go too well. This site uses a lot of what we in business call “legacy code” which is old code that doesn’t work on the newest systems because it contains old features and commands that have been depreciated, renamed to something else, or just changed in a way so the old commands don’t do the same thing.

After a few days of trying to fix errors and not really getting anywhere we migrated the site back to the old server, and that glitched as well, which is why everyone could create posts but not view or comment on any of them.
